China has evacuated more than 31,000 people from danger zones in Hainan Province in the southern part of the country due to ongoing heavy rainfall across the island. Over 300 millimeters of rain have fallen in 24 towns, with the highest daily rainfall in Changfeng reaching 452.1 millimeters. Chinese authorities have implemented emergency measures, including closing schools, imposing traffic controls, and raising the flood response level to Level Two. Meanwhile, Wanning has activated a Level One flood response. Authorities continue to monitor the situation closely to take necessary precautions against rain- and flood-related disasters.
